Upon removal of .jpg extension (from a downloaded file) ('cos i hate extensions), the mac can no longer identify the file. Problem akin to bugs 218603 and 129979.
Manually replacing the .jpg extension fixes the problem but is not a solution I wish to use.
Reproducible: Always
Steps to Reproduce:
1.Save any jpg image off a page.
2.remove .jpg from filename
3.Mac will now be unable to identify the file.
